Abstract:
In the past decade, many researchers have addressed the intersection between social movements and collective memories. Social movements can become the objects of collective memories, while collective memories can shape the dynamic evolution of social movements. Meanwhile, both social movements and collective memories are subjected to the influence of changes in the political environment. Using Hong Kong as the case, the talk will discuss existing studies as well as future research directions concerning the memory-movement nexus.
